7. Best Practices for Developing VR Content for Educational Platforms
Imagine stepping into a virtual classroom where historical figures come to life, allowing students to engage with key moments from the past as if they were part of the action. This isn’t just a fantasy; it’s the future of learning through Virtual Reality (VR). In fact, studies show that students are 70% more likely to remember information presented in an immersive VR setting compared to traditional methods. To create effective VR content for educational platforms, developers should focus on interactivity and relatability, ensuring that users can not only watch but also actively participate in their learning journey. By incorporating real-world scenarios and gamified elements, they can create a compelling experience that keeps students captivated and engaged.
One key best practice is to design content that aligns with educational goals while also catering to different learning styles. For instance, some students thrive in hands-on environments, while others benefit from visual aids or auditory cues. Final Conclusions
In conclusion, the integration of virtual reality (VR) into Learning Management Systems (LMS) represents a transformative shift in educational methodologies, providing learners with an immersive experience that significantly enhances engagement and comprehension. By leveraging VR technology, educational institutions can create dynamic learning environments that stimulate curiosity and facilitate deeper understanding of complex concepts. This evolution not only caters to diverse learning styles but also prepares students for a workforce that increasingly values digital proficiency and adaptability.
Looking ahead, the potential for VR in LMS is vast, as advancements in technology continue to reshape the landscape of education. As developers create more intuitive and accessible VR solutions, we can expect a wider adoption in both traditional and online learning settings. This shift will ultimately empower educators to design personalized learning experiences, fostering collaboration and creativity among students. Thus, the future of virtual reality in learning not only enhances user experience but also redefines the possibilities of education, making it more interactive, engaging, and effective for learners around the globe.
